Presenter's Biography:

Chester was called to the Bar in 2020 and is a member of Sir Oswald Cheung's Chambers. He practices in land and property matters, including building management disputes. Other than the Court of Appeal, Court of First Instance and District Court, he has also appeared in the Lands Tribunal and Building Appeal Tribunal.
 
Objective:

This course aims to summarize selected building management cases in the past year to help practitioners stay up-to-date on the latest developments of this area.

While this course is intended to be a case update rather than a comprehensive review of all building management issues, there will be discussions to explore the issues touched upon in these cases. Where appropriate, there will also be sufficient summary of the relevant area of law so as to enable participants to grasp the significance of the issues discussed in the cases and to anticipate some potential problems arising from these issues in future cases.
 
Outline:

The format of the course will be a series of case updates, organized by the relevant issues to ease the participants' understanding. Summary and commentary on the law will be given at the appropriate time to allow participants to understand the significance of the issues discussed.

Some key building management issues addressed by these cases include:-

  • Construction of conveyancing documents
  • Adverse possession in the building management context
  • Waiver, estoppel, acquiescence in the building management context
  • Considerations of illegality in the building management context
  • Quasi-easement
  • The element of reasonableness in construing rights and duties in the building management context
  • Other miscellaneous matters under the Building Management Ordinance (Cap. 344) or Buildings Ordinance (Cap. 123)
